Enable recursion when requested by forwarders or users
Forwarders do not work unless recursion is enabled. Also, allow users to
set recursion explicitly when they want BIND9 set up by the charm to act
as a full-service resolver.
Documentation has been updated to warn users to set ACLs when enabling
forwarders or recursion to avoid it from being a open resolver.
Change-Id: I53d53decbbae12e0b743aa34421d63a5a5c892f1
Closes-Bug: #1776952
Co-Authored-By: Pedro <email address hidden>
Reviewed: https:/ /review. openstack. org/584691 /git.openstack. org/cgit/ openstack/ charm-designate -bind/commit/ ?id=4132f05db4b 7bc3a64980a6adb 10028c36604203
Committed: https:/
Submitter: Zuul
Branch: master
commit 4132f05db4b7bc3 a64980a6adb1002 8c36604203
Author: Nobuto Murata <email address hidden>
Date: Mon Jul 23 11:24:54 2018 +0900
Enable recursion when requested by forwarders or users
Forwarders do not work unless recursion is enabled. Also, allow users to
set recursion explicitly when they want BIND9 set up by the charm to act
as a full-service resolver.
Documentation has been updated to warn users to set ACLs when enabling
forwarders or recursion to avoid it from being a open resolver.
Change-Id: I53d53decbbae12 e0b743aa34421d6 3a5a5c892f1
Closes-Bug: #1776952
Co-Authored-By: Pedro <email address hidden>